Google Goes Beyond Lip Service With Captivating Ad About Gender Transition

In a new ad for its "Google Your Business" campaign, the search engine giant profiles businesswoman Hailee Bland Walsh, the owner of City Gym in Kansas City, Missouri.

Walsh isn't just any entrepreneur, as we soon learn: City Gym has become a haven for trans men looking to develop their new masculine bodies. Jacob, one of those men, is profiled in the ad, produced by Venables Bell & Partners.

"I'm excited to get in there and build this body I've always wanted," Jacob says of City Gym.

Walsh says, "there was never an intention to create a space specifically for any group, but what a testament it is to create a space where any group feels comfortable."

What's truly impressive about the ad, though, is that it doesn't pretend to be something its not.  Instead, it demonstrates how a product—in this case, Google My Business tools for small businesses—can be of service to a community.
